Oracle has released the sixth update of version 4.2 of VirtualBox, but the website has been down for some time due to technical problems. VirtualBox can be used to install other operating systems in a virtual environment on a computer. In this way it is possible to use different operating systems on the same hardware side by side and at the same time. VirtualBox is available for Windows XP and above, OS X, Linux, and Solaris, and is capable of many guest operating systems to turn.

Version 4.2 of VirtualBox brings, among other things, improved support for Windows 8. In addition, Linux, Solaris and OS X now allow virtual machines to be started at boot time and files can be copied to Linux hosts using drag&drop. In version 4.2.12, the following changes and improvements have also been made:

The following items were fixed and/or added:

  • VMM: fixed a Guru Meditation on putting Linux guest CPU online if nested paging is disabled
  • VMM: invalidate TLB entries even for non-present pages
  • GUI: Multi-screen support: fixed a crash on visual-mode change
  • GUI: Multi-screen support: disabled guest-screens should now remain disabled on visual-mode change
  • GUI: Multi-screen support: handle host/guest screen plugging/unplugging in different visual-modes
  • GUI: Multi-screen support: seamless mode: fixed a bug when empty seamless screens were represented by fullscreen windows
  • GUI: Multi-screen support: each machine window in multi-screen configuration should have correct menu-bar now (Mac OS X hosts)
  • GUI: Multi-screen support: machine window View menu should have correct content in seamless/fullscreen mode now (Mac OS X hosts)
  • GUI: VM manager: vertical scroll-bars should be now updated on content/window resize
  • GUI: VM settings: fixed crash on machine state-change event
  • GUI: don’t show warnings about enabled or disabled mouse integration if the VM was restored from a saved state
  • Virtio-net: properly announce that the guest has to handle partial TCP checksums (bug #9380)
  • Storage: Fixed incorrect alignment of VDI images causing disk size changes when using snapshots (bug #11597)
  • Audio: fixed broken ALSA & PulseAudio on some Linux hosts due to invalid symbol resolution (bug #11615)
  • PS/2 keyboard: re-apply keyboard repeat delay and rate after a VM was restored from a saved state (bug #10933)
  • BIOS: updated DMI processor information table (type 4): corrected L1 & L2 cache table handles
  • Timekeeping: fix several issues which can lead to incorrect time, Solaris guests sporadically showed time going briefly back to Jan 1 1970
  • Main/Metrics: disk metrics are collected properly when software RAID, symbolic links or rootfs are used on Linux hosts
  • VBoxManage: don’t stay paused after a snapshot was created and the VM was running before
  • VBoxManage: introduced controlvm nicpromisc (bug #11423)
  • VBoxManage: don’t crash on controlvm guestmemoryballoon if the VM isn’t running (bug #11639)
  • VBoxHeadless: don’t filter guest property events as this would affect all clients (bug #11644)
  • Guest control: prevent double CR in the output generated by guest commands and do NLS conversion
  • Linux hosts / guests: fixed build errors on Linux 3.5 and newer kernels if the CONFIG_UIDGID_STRICT_TYPE_CHECKS config option is enabled (bug #11664)
  • Linux Additions: handle fall-back to VESA driver on RedHat-based guests if vboxvideo cannot be loaded
  • Linux Additions: RHEL/OEL/CentOS 6.4 compile fix (bug #11586)
  • Linux Additions: Debian Linux kernel 3.2.0-4 (3.2.39) compile fix (bug #11634)
  • Linux Additions: added auto-logon support for Linux guests using LightDM as the display manager
  • Windows Additions: Support for multimonitor. Dynamic enable/disable or secondary virtual monitors. Support for XPDM/WDDM based guests
  • X11 Additions: support X.Org Server 1.14 (bug #11609)
